Le mar 28/01/2003 à 20:30, Tibor Pittich a écrit :

> sorry, if this question is stupid, but i would ask to format of these
> new options, especially limit-rate, if i want use it in global
> urpmi.cfg. unfortunately documentation (man page) isn't updated with
> this new features, but it is useful (therefore i'm requested it;)
> ) maybe not only for me.
> 
> i'm trying change urpmi.cfg like this:
> 
> {
>   limit-rate 10k  or limit-rate : 10k
> }
> 
> or add these variations into source definition, but always i get syntax
> error.
> 
> if i try put arbitrary of these lines which i see in changelog:
> 
> {
>   verify-rpm : on|yes
>   verify-rpm
>   no-verify-rpm
> }
> 
> there is no syntax error message.
> 
> is this problem in implementation (bug?) or only my configuration
> mistake/ignorance ?

This is a mistake from me, an error message is displayed *BUT* the
option is taken into account by urpmi (and not by urpmi.update).

I fix the error message and the support in urpmi.update and
urpmi.addmedia.
